How do I solve 4(x+3)-(x-1)=40

The answer is: x = 9

Here's how I got my answer:

Step 1: Simplify the brackets. Which leaves us with 4(x+3)-x+1=40

Step 2: Expand it. Which leaves us with 4x+12-x+1=40

Step 3: Simplify 4x+12-x+1 to 3x+13. Which leaves us with 3x+13=40

Step 4: Subtract 13 from both sides. Which leaves us with 3x=40-13

Step 5: Simplify 40-13 to 27. Which leaves us with 3x = 27

Step 6: Divide both sides by 3, leaving us with our answer, x = 9.

Find the area. Simplify your answer.

Answer:

  x^2 +8x +12

Step-by-step explanation:

The area is the product of length and width. The product can be simplified using the distributive property.

  A = LW

  A = (x +6)(x +2) = x(x +2) +6(x +2)

  A = x^2 +2x +6x +12

  A = x^2 +8x +12
